Double pane window replacement involves removing existing windows that consist of two glass panels separated by a space, and installing new units that provide better insulation and energy efficiency. This service typically includes measuring the existing window openings, selecting suitable replacement units, and carefully installing the new double pane windows to ensure a proper fit. The process aims to improve the overall comfort of a property by reducing drafts, minimizing heat transfer, and enhancing the window’s durability against everyday wear and tear.

This service helps resolve common issues associated with older or damaged windows, such as excessive drafts, condensation between glass panes, difficulty opening or closing, and increased energy bills. Double pane windows are designed to provide better insulation compared to single-pane options, making them a practical upgrade for homeowners looking to improve indoor comfort and reduce utility costs. Additionally, replacing old windows can help prevent issues like fogging or water infiltration, which can lead to further damage if left unaddressed.

The overview below groups typical Double Pane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Flint,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For routine repairs like replacing a single broken pane or sealing leaks, local contractors typically charge between $150 and $400. Many small jobs fall within this range, though costs can vary based on window size and accessibility.

Standard Double Pane Replacement - Replacing standard-sized double-pane windows usually costs between $300 and $800 per window. Most projects in Flint and nearby areas land in this middle range, with fewer reaching higher prices for custom or difficult-to-access installations.

Full Window Replacement - When replacing multiple windows or upgrading entire sections of a home, costs often range from $2,000 to $7,000. Larger, more complex projects can exceed this range, but many jobs stay within these typical bounds.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Custom-sized or multi-window installations, especially in larger homes or commercial properties, can reach $10,000 or more. These projects are less common and tend to fall into the higher cost tiers due to scope and material requ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of upgrading to double pane windows? Double pane windows can improve energy efficiency, reduce noise, and enhance overall comfort in your home by providing better insulation compared to single pane options.

How do I know if my current windows need replacement? Signs such as drafts, condensation between panes, difficulty opening or closing, and visible damage can indicate that your existing windows may need to be replaced with new double pane units.

Are there different types of double pane windows available? Yes, there are various styles and designs, including casement, sliding, and picture windows, allowing homeowners to choose options that best suit their home's aesthetic and functional needs.

What should I consider when choosing a contractor for double pane window replacement? It's important to look for experienced local service providers with good reputations, who can handle the installation properly and ensure the windows are installed correctly for optimal performance.

Can double pane window replacements be customized to match existing home styles? Yes, many local contractors offer a range of frame materials, finishes, and styles to help integrate new windows seamlessly with the home's design.
